Patch Manager Plus, an all-round patching solution, offers automated patch deployment for Windows, macOS, and Linux endpoints, plus patching support for 350+ third-party applications You can use it to patch computers within LAN and WAN.

  • User-Friendly Interface
    Froxlor provides a clean and intuitive interface that makes it easy for users to manage their hosting environment. The interface is designed to be accessible to users of all experience levels, from beginners to advanced administrators.
  • Resource Efficiency
    Froxlor is lightweight and efficient, which allows it to perform well even on servers with limited resources. This makes it a good choice for small to medium-sized hosting providers who want to minimize overhead.
  • Customizable
    Froxlor offers a high degree of customization, allowing users to tailor the control panel to their specific needs. This includes custom branding and the ability to add or remove features.
  • Open Source
    As an open-source project, Froxlor is free to use and offers transparency in its development. Users can contribute to its improvement or tailor it to their specific requirements.
  • Multiple OS Support
    Froxlor supports various Linux distributions, allowing flexibility in choosing the underlying operating system for your web hosting environment.

Possible disadvantages

  • Limited Features Compared to Some Competitors
    Froxlor may not offer as many advanced features or third-party integrations as some commercial alternatives, which could be a drawback for users needing more comprehensive solutions.
  • Community Support
    Being an open-source project with a smaller user base, Froxlor primarily relies on community support, which may not be as robust or fast as the support provided by commercial options.
  • Lack of Windows Support
    Froxlor does not support Windows operating systems, which could be a significant inconvenience for users or organizations that rely on a Windows server environment.
  • Potential for Security Gaps
    As with many open-source projects, the responsibility for security updates and patches may not be as promptly addressed compared to larger, commercial offerings.

Overall verdict

  • ManageEngine Patch Manager Plus is a robust and effective solution for organizations seeking to improve their patch management processes. Its comprehensive feature set, combined with ease of use and reliable performance, makes it a strong choice for businesses of all sizes.

Why this product is good

  • ManageEngine Patch Manager Plus is well-regarded for its user-friendly interface, extensive patch management capabilities, and automation features. It supports a wide range of operating systems and third-party applications, making it a versatile solution for various IT environments. Users appreciate its ability to streamline the patching process, reduce vulnerabilities, and ensure compliance with security standards.

Recommended for

    This solution is recommended for IT administrators and organizations that require a reliable way to manage the patching of multiple systems and applications, especially those with diverse IT environments or limited resources to dedicate to manual patch management. It’s particularly suitable for medium to large enterprises looking to enhance their security posture and compliance efforts.
